    How To Make Ginger Drink

    Ginger drink is a refreshing and healthy beverage made from fresh ginger root. It is known for its spicy flavour and many health benefits, including aiding digestion, easing nausea, and boosting immunity. Making ginger drink at home is simple and can be enjoyed hot or cold, depending on your preference. Here is how to make ginger drink.

    1. Gather Your Ingredients and Materials
      To prepare a ginger drink, you will need one large piece of fresh ginger (about 2 to 3 inches), two to three cups of water, lemon juice or honey (optional for taste), a knife, a grater or peeler, a pot, a strainer, and a cup or jug.
    2. Wash and Prepare the Ginger
      Rinse the ginger root under clean water to remove any dirt. Use a knife or the edge of a spoon to peel the skin off. Then grate the ginger finely or slice it thinly, depending on what tools you have. The finer you cut it, the stronger the flavour will be.
    3. Boil the Ginger
      Pour the water into a pot and add the grated or sliced ginger. Bring it to a boil over medium heat. Once it starts boiling, reduce the heat and let it simmer for about 10 to 15 minutes. This helps to extract the flavour and nutrients from the ginger.
    4. Strain the Drink
      After simmering, remove the pot from the heat and let the liquid cool slightly. Pour the mixture through a strainer into a jug or cup to remove the ginger pieces. At this point, you can stir in a teaspoon of honey or a squeeze of lemon juice if you want to sweeten or flavour the drink.
    5. Serve and Enjoy
      You can drink the ginger tea warm, especially on cold days or when you’re feeling unwell. For a chilled version, allow the ginger drink to cool completely, then refrigerate it and serve with ice. It can also be stored in the fridge for up to two days.
